Output fd9323b7fbce4acfa10877cb50c41d398eb1854173aa92d5e5853b33ce6ae602:1

value
670553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ca4db5132f49d9e0592b272f3f23c11b04cc080 OP_EQUAL
address
3FyGpuyVwgF6gunnNfqYJ2Cpm3zUnpWgYr
transaction
fd9323b7fbce4acfa10877cb50c41d398eb1854173aa92d5e5853b33ce6ae602
spent
true